3. Remove the Tow Beam and lift the Crate off of the Shipping Pallet.
4. Remove the Hardware Plastic Bag, the Chipper Hopper, and the packing
material from inside the Shredder Hopper.
5. Using a 1/2" Wrench, remove the Lag Bolt and Washer securing the front
of the Chipper/Shredder frame to Shipping Pallet (Figure 4). This Bolt and
Washer may be discarded.
6. With the help of another person, carefully roll the DR
CHIPPER/SHREDDER from the Shipping Pallet, resting it on the front
frame support.
7. Compare the contents on the Shipping Pallet and in the Plastic Bag with
the parts supplied list on the previous page. If any of the parts are missing,
contact 1-800-DR-OWNER (376-9637). You will need packaging to return
the machine; do not discard your packaging material until you are fully
satisfied with your new DR CHIPPER/SHREDDER.
Attaching the Tow Beam and Hitch Plate
Tools Needed:
7/16" Wrench
Two 1/2" Wrenches
1. Place the Tow Beam on top of and in the center of the Axle between the
Axle Supports. Put the U-Bolt around the Axle from underneath and up
through the two holes on the Tow Beam (Figure 5). Install two 1/4"- 20
Lock Nuts on the U-Bolt with a7/16" Wrench but do not tighten.
2. Lift the machine and align the Hole the Tow Beam with the Hole in the
Front Frame Support and insert a 5/16"- 18 x 1" Bolt down through the
Frame and through the Tow Beam (Figure 6).
3. With this Bolt in place, block up the Tow Beam so that you can easily install
a 5/16" Flat Washer and a 5/16" - 18 Lock Nut on the Bolt from under the
Tow Beam; but do not tighten.
4. Re-check the center of the Tow Beam on the Axle and tighten the two Lock
Nuts on the U-Bolt.
5. Now tighten the 5/16"-18 Lock Nut to secure the Front Frame Support to
the Tow Beam with two 1/2" Wrenches.
6. Attach the Hitch Plate to the Tow Beam with two 5/16"- 18 x 1" Bolts and
two 5/16"-18 Lock Nuts (Figure 6). Tighten with two 1/2" Wrenches.
